In today’s fast-paced world, competition is fierce, and it’s becoming increasingly challenging to stand out from the crowd. To succeed, individuals need to step out of their comfort zones and master new skills continually. This is where personalized skills development comes into play.
Traditionally, we tend to stick to what we already know. We might take a course here or there, but we rarely devote serious time and effort to learning new skills. However, this approach can lead to stagnation, boredom, and being left behind in our careers or personal lives.
Personalized skills development allows us to break free from the monotony of routine and explore new horizons. It enables us to identify and strengthen our unique strengths and talents while also improving our weaknesses. By investing in ourselves, we gain confidence, build competence and increase our marketability.
Skills development is critical in today’s job market. Employers seek individuals who demonstrate flexibility, creativity, and a willingness to learn. By continuously up-skilling, we can demonstrate our commitment to professional growth and success, making us more attractive to employers and potentially leading to higher salaries, better opportunities, and job security.
Moreover, personalized skills development can benefit our personal lives as well. We can learn new hobbies, optimize our health and wellness, and enhance our social lives. By pursuing activities that align with our interests and passions, we can ultimately lead a more fulfilling life.
